FeaturedAlaska State Fair 2026
Alaska's largest annual celebration returns to Palmer for 18 days of concerts, carnival rides, rodeo, record-setting giant vegetables (the Giant Cabbage Weigh-Off is Sept 4), local food, and hundreds of vendors. 2026 concerts include Ziggy Marley, The Beach Boys, Lyle Lovett, Cake, AJR, deadmau5, and Modest Mouse. Gate admission applies. Tickets and full schedule: alaskastatefair.org.
